Facilities Ticket — Cleaning Crew Access, Brindle Annex

For new starters handling evening lock-up: the Sorano Cleaning crew arrives nightly at 21:30 via the annex side door. Check their rota sheet, note arrival in the log, and ensure the storeroom is relocked afterward. To let them through the side door, enter the access code below.

badge for yaweg-hafog: bdg-GX-6

Action item: The Relayn deploy-status bot silently dropped updates when the pipeline API paginated results, so responders believed a rollback had completed when it had not. We will add pagination handling, a staleness banner, and an integration test. Until merged, verify deploy state directly in the pipeline console, documented at the page below.

runbook for kahop-kajop: https://rundeck.ordinio.test/display/secrets/pipeline/issue/pages/repo/browse/e5732776e07d1285107e5aeb

# Watchdog settings — Pembleton Kiosk v4
# Release manager notes: the watchdog kills and relaunches the shell after
# three missed heartbeats (interval set below, default 5s). Do not ship a
# build with heartbeats disabled; field units will wedge on signage loops.
# Every restart is logged with build number and uptime so release regressions
# are traceable. The restart log persists to the watchdog database, which must
# be reachable at boot. Set the database connection string on the next line.

primary connection of yagep-kahip = redis://giliel_svc:zYiKsLL2PLpfPL@db-348f.xolmarsys.corp:5432/fenwyn